The VAS Lead is responsible for overseeing special projects within the warehouse’s Value-Added Services (VAS) area, ensuring operations run efficiently, accurately, and safely. This role involves supervising temporary staff, managing workflows, and ensuring projects like packaging and labeling are completed according to specifications. Key duties include verifying incoming and finished products, maintaining accurate records and spreadsheets, creating and validating receipts and labels, and ensuring quality control throughout all processes. The role also supports inventory management, including cycle counts and space optimization, and helps monitor equipment use and workplace safety in compliance with OSHA and SQF standards. The VAS Lead acts as a communication link between staff and management, maintains internal communications, and contributes to performance tracking through reporting and time studies. The position requires leadership experience, strong communication and organizational skills, basic math and computer proficiency (MS Office), and knowledge of shipping/receiving operations. It also involves physical activity such as lifting up to 50 lbs, standing and walking for extended periods, and performing detailed, multi-tasked work under deadlines.
